Broker Review Scams: Separating Legitimate Advice from Deception

Navigating the world of trading can be challenging. With countless platforms vying for your attention, it's crucial to discern legitimate reviews from deceptive ones. Unfortunately, dishonest individuals are increasingly using fake reviews to entice unsuspecting investors into unsuitable investments.

A authentic broker review should provide a balanced assessment of the platform's strengths and cons, along with customer experiences. Be wary of reviews that are overly positive or negative as these may be made up. Look for reviews that are comprehensive and provide evidence.

Pay attention to the origin of the review. Are they unknown? Do they have a background of providing reliable information? Examine the reviewer's motivation. Are they affiliated with the brokerage in any way?

It's also essential to conduct your own research beyond relying solely on reviews. Explore the broker's website, regulatory status, and contact details. Remember, making informed investment decisions requires a analytical approach and relying on multiple sources.
